The short version

Casa de Oro-Mount Helix is significantly wealthier than the US average, with a median household income of $125,107. Population has held roughly steady since 2000. 47%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. Median home value has roughly tripled since 2000, reaching $952,400. Poverty is rare here, at 4.8% of residents. It ranks in the top 5% of US cities for household income.
